About

Mohammed Sadiki is a leading figure in plant genetic resources and conservation, with a particular focus on the sustainable management and utilization of faba bean (Vicia faba L.) diversity. His foundational work, "Diversity maintenance and use of Vicia faba L. genetic resources," has garnered over 220 citations, establishing him as a key voice in the preservation of agricultural biodiversity. Sadiki’s research bridges the gap between in situ conservation and practical breeding, emphasizing how traditional farming systems can serve as dynamic reservoirs of genetic variation. His contributions have been instrumental in shaping strategies for the maintenance of crop diversity in the face of climate change and intensive agriculture. Beyond this seminal paper, Sadiki’s work continues to influence policies on genetic resource conservation in the Mediterranean region, where faba bean is a staple crop. His impact is measured not only in citations but also in the application of his findings to enhance food security and sustainable farming practices. For students and researchers, Sadiki’s career exemplifies how rigorous field-based research can inform global conservation efforts and support the livelihoods of smallholder farmers.
